Wolves Peewee LL2 win over Dundalk

The Shelburne Wolves Peewee LL2 team earned another win during the round-robin playoff series after leaving the ice with a 6–1 win over Dundalk on Saturday.

“We’re doing really well in the playoffs,” Said head coach Rob Fetterly. “That was our fourth win in seven games. We’ve had four wins, a tie and a loss.”

The Wolves are playing in the third tier of the league which has a total of 24 teams.

In Saturday’s game the Wolves played a stellar defence by keeping the Dundalk team to the outside and stopping the attackers from getting in scoring position in front of the net.

Goalie Brandon Donnelly came within a minute of getting the shut-out but a short scramble in front of the net saw a Dundalk goal with less than a minute remaining on the clock.

The squad has improved their play since entering the playoffs and the results are seen in their playoff record.

“They’re playing their positions better, they’re getting a jump on their speed and going to the net for the rebounds. We picked up three rebound goals today, which is something we’ve been practicing on. The team is looking more for the passes and looking to forecheck more,” Fetterly said of what the team has been doing right.

The Wolves’ goals were the result of some well coordinated play in the Dundalk zone and capitalizing on opportunities when the chance was there.

The late game goal may have stopped the shut-out but as Fetterly pointed out, “The other teams word hard to get that goal.”

The Peewee LL2 team still has a few games left in the season as the wrap up the playoff round.

The Peewees will return to home ice at CDRC on Saturday, March 8, to host the team from Midland. The puck drop is scheduled for 10:30 a.m.
